Integrating AI for Efficient Tree Care and Maintenance
Integrating AI into tree care routines offers a promising approach to enhancing efficiency and promoting healthier landscapes. Advanced algorithms can analyze vast datasets, including historical weather patterns, soil composition, and tree species characteristics, to provide tailored care instructions. This technology enables intelligent decisions regarding watering schedules, fertilization needs, and pest management, ensuring each tree receives the optimal treatment.
AI-powered irrigation control systems, for instance, can learn and adapt based on real-time data, minimizing water wastage and promoting sustainable practices. By combining machine learning with remote sensing technologies, AI can detect early signs of stress or disease in trees, allowing for prompt intervention. This proactive approach to tree care not only saves time but also contributes to the overall well-being of urban greening initiatives.
AI-Guided Irrigation Control Systems: Revolutionizing Outdoor Spaces
AI-guided irrigation control systems are transforming residential landscaping, offering a new level of efficiency and sustainability. By leveraging machine learning algorithms, these intelligent systems can optimize water usage based on real-time weather data, plant health assessments, and specific landscaping requirements. This not only reduces water waste but also ensures that plants receive the precise amount of hydration they need for optimal growth.
Imagine a landscape where every plant is nurtured with precision, where water isn’t squandered, and where outdoor spaces thrive. AI-powered irrigation control systems make this vision a reality. They learn the unique needs of different plant species, adjust watering schedules dynamically, and even predict potential issues like drought or overwatering, allowing for proactive interventions.
